> - The system is a Linux Debian one so it is using inetd, and to
> avoid incompatibilities with this distribution I don't want to use
> solutions that are not officialy supported...
>
> Is there another solution ???
If you are interested in being "loyal" to your distribution
(nice distribution, BTW :-) ), then you should look forward some
packages like ezmlm-src, qmail-src etc in your nearest Debian mirror,
in the contrib section. You'll have to have some development tools
installed (make, gcc, the library headers etc).
